当前位置:首页 > 内存 > 正文

一个虚拟机用多少内存(虚拟机需要多大内存合适)

  • 内存
  • 2023-12-30 22:59:39
  • 9738
安装VM虚拟机需要多大内存?1.安装VM虚拟机所需内存一般为512M-2G。最终,这取决于虚拟机上运行的程序。

2.因为大多数应用程序都是32位的。Microsoft对32位程序有限制,这意味着它们不能使用超过2GB的内存。因此,后期需要实现64位系统。

3.所以作为虚拟机,大多数程序不需要超过2GB的内存,1GB对于大多数程序来说就足够了。如果只是用来运行一些小程序,512M就合适了。4.当然,这取决于系统的总内存。如果足够大的话,可以再高一点。如果系统内存本来就紧张,512M-1G是最佳容量。虚拟机

(1)VM虚拟机是“虚拟PC”软件。它允许您在一台机器上同时运行两个或多个Windows、DOS和LINUX系统。与“多重启动”系统相比,VM虚拟机采用了完全不同的概念。多启动系统一次只能在一个系统上运行,当系统改变时,必须重新启动机器。随着该软件用户数量的增加,从10.0开始提供了不同语言的版本。

(2)VMWare确实是“同时”运行的。许多操作系统就像标准Windows应用程序一样在主系统平台上运行。另外,你可以为每个操作系统创建虚拟分区和配置,而无需接触真实硬盘上的数据,可以用网卡将多个虚拟机连接到一个局域网中,极其方便。

虚拟机划分多大的内存给虚拟机?

一些问题的简短回答如下:

1.虚拟机需要分配40G硬盘空间吗?

根据选择的模式不同,虚拟机分配硬盘空间有两种模式,一种是厚格式(thick),一种是是薄供给型号(thin)。对于第一种模式,如果你给虚拟机分配了40GB的空间,那么抱歉,虚拟机实际上在你的物理硬盘上给虚拟机分配了40GB的空间。除虚拟机外,该空间不能被其他程序使用。在保存虚拟机文件的文件夹中,您将看到一个40GB的vmdk文件。如果你使用第二种精简分配模式,那么如果你分配了40GB的空间,这40GB实际上并不会立即分配在物理硬盘上,而是取决于你的虚拟机系统的实际空间大小。比如安装完win7之后,大概会是8GB左右,那么在你的物理硬盘上,你会看到一个8GB左右大小的vmdk文件。以后当你安装软件或者写入其他数据时,随时都会在物理硬盘上占用新的空间,最多可以占用40GB。

2.虚拟和占用内存:

为虚拟机分配内存后,虚拟机会向物理主机获取内存。内存中已分配的内存量。这个内存不是磁盘上的,而是物理主机的实际内存。
需要注意的是,一般情况下虚拟机在物理硬盘上占用与虚拟机内存大小相同大小的硬盘空间作为系统交换区。这会占用物理主机的物理硬盘。

3.虚拟机安装软件占用空间问题

参考第一个问题的答案,如果是厚格式,那么这个空间是已经被占用了。如果是精简配置模式,安装软件时会占用硬盘空间。

4.如何彻底删除虚拟系统?

删除虚拟机一般有两种方式。一种是在界面上右键删除虚拟机。另一种选择是直接删除虚拟机所在的所有文件夹。推荐使用第一种模式。
如果您想删除虚拟化软件(如vmwarestation),最好自己使用vmwareuninstall。这样不能直接删除虚拟化软件文件夹。

5.如果遇到问题需要重装虚拟系统吗?

无需重新安装。重新安装通常仅被视为最后的手段。
遇到问题时,一般首先要考虑的是查看虚拟机日志或者虚拟化软件日志。您通常可以发现问题并在发现问题后立即解决它们。这可以提高您的虚拟化知识。如果实在无法解决的话,就只能重新安装了。

希望以上回答可以帮助到您。

虚拟机开机后会占用多少内存?

启动虚拟机后,占用真机可用内存512M。如果关闭虚拟机,虚拟机刚刚占用的512M会自动释放给真机上的其他软件使用。

虚拟机开启时,占用512M。在虚拟机系统中实际使用200M还是300M并不重要,因为对于真机来说,开启时占用512M。

真机内存2G,虚拟机分配512M。启动虚拟机后,真机可用内存多占用了512M。如果关闭虚拟机,虚拟机刚刚占用的512M将会自动释放出来,供真机上的其他软件使用。

扩展信息

虚拟机分为两种:需要同时运行的多个虚拟机。出于某种目的,它需要与主机隔离运行。

对于第一类,需要根据物理机的实际配置(处理器和内存数量,尤其是内存)合理分配。一般情况下,会分配较少的内存。

在第二种情况下,通常运行一个虚拟机实例就足够了。这时候虚拟机内存可以分配大一些。例如,总共可以分配8G物理内存给win8.1开发环境的5G。

需要注意的是,当物理机内存比较小时,如果给虚拟机分配过多的内存,会导致主机卡顿。一般情况下,至少会为主机保留1G。例如,2G内存的物理机,运行的虚拟机总内存不超过1G;对于4G内存的物理机,虚拟机的总内存不超过2.5G。如果是1G内存的话,虚拟机的内存不要超过384M。

用户不会被允许为虚拟机设置太高的内存,因为主机本身需要内存,运行虚拟机也需要内存。只有剩余的内存可以分配给虚拟机。如果全部分配给虚拟机,主机在内存不足时运行速度会比较慢,但系统会强制回收虚拟机的内存。

VM虚拟机10运行时会占用多少运存?32位版的虚拟机软件本身占用的内存非常少,一般只有50到100MB内存。
但是虚拟机本身直接调用物理机的物理内存,这是由虚拟机设置中设置的内存大小决定的。
此外,由于32位系统最多只能处理4GB内存,同时必须保留一部分内存供系统和硬件使用,因此系统实际可调用的内存远小于4GB。为了获得更好的虚拟体验,建议使用64位版本的系统,并在BIOS设置中启用对应处理器的虚拟化技术支持。